A sustained decline has pushed Kesar Terminals & Infrastructure Ltd to a fresh 52-week low of Rs 58 on 30 Mar 2026, marking a significant 47% drop from its peak of Rs 109 within the last year. This downturn comes amid broader market weakness, but the stock’s underperformance is notably sharper than its sector and benchmark indices.
Kesar Terminals & Infrastructure Ltd Falls to 52-Week Low of Rs 58 as Sell-Off Deepens

Price Action and Market Context

For the fifth consecutive session, Kesar Terminals & Infrastructure Ltd closed lower, breaching its 52-week low at Rs 58. This decline contrasts with the broader market, where the Sensex, despite a recent gap down opening, remains only 1.3% above its own 52-week low of 71,425.01. The Sensex has lost 2.95% over the past three weeks, but Kesar Terminals has underperformed considerably, with a one-year return of -15.01% compared to the Sensex’s -6.52%. The stock’s fall also outpaces the Miscellaneous sector’s 2.5% decline, signalling stock-specific pressures. Financial Performance and Growth Trends

The company’s long-term financial trajectory has been subdued. Over the past five years, net sales have declined at an annual rate of 2.18%, while operating profit has remained flat. Despite this, recent quarterly results show a contrasting picture: the latest quarter recorded the highest PAT at Rs 1.36 crore and EPS at Rs 1.25, indicating some improvement in profitability. However, this uptick has not translated into positive investor sentiment, as the stock continues to slide. Valuation and Risk Metrics

The valuation landscape for Kesar Terminals & Infrastructure Ltd is complex. The company currently carries a negative book value, which signals weak long-term fundamental strength. Its debt-to-equity ratio averages zero, indicating limited leverage, but this does not offset concerns arising from stagnant sales growth and flat operating profits over the last five years. The stock’s price-to-earnings ratio is not straightforward to interpret given the company’s micro-cap status and recent earnings volatility. Despite a 17.7% rise in profits over the past year, the stock has generated a negative return of 15.01%, suggesting that valuation metrics alone do not capture the full risk profile. Technical Indicators

The technical picture for Kesar Terminals & Infrastructure Ltd is predominantly bearish. Weekly and monthly MACD readings are bearish or mildly bearish, while Bollinger Bands also indicate downward pressure. The KST and Dow Theory signals align with this trend, showing mild to moderate bearishness across weekly and monthly timeframes. The stock’s position below all major moving averages further confirms the negative momentum.
